Ind. Code § 16-19-10-6

Current through P.L. 171-2024
Section 16-19-10-6 - State department surveys; confidentiality
(a) The state department may conduct surveys:
(1) concerning the health status of Indiana residents; and
(2) evaluating the effectiveness of the state department's programs.
(b) Information contained in a survey described in subsection (a) that identifies or could be used to determine the identity of a person responding to the survey is confidential. All other information contained in the survey is not confidential and is available for inspection and copying under IC 5-14-3.
(c) For purposes of this section, "survey" does not include data or information that is generated, collected, or transferred under IC 16-21-6-7 or IC 16-39-5-3.

IC 16-19-10-6

As added by P.L. 261-2003, SEC.14.
